Job description
Interested in working with people who have a difficult relationship with food? North Cumbria Adult Eating Disorder Service (NCAEDS) are looking for a ...
To assist in the delivery of care to service users who have a variety of needs, under the direction of a registered practitioner.
To implement and evaluate care within a prescribed framework as a member of the care team ensuring that high quality, individualised care is delivered and that this promotes recovery and wellbeing and maximises independence.
To complete physical health checks including phlebotomy and ECG, in line with NICE guidelines.

Education and Qualification
Essential
- Completion of a competency-based programme within probationary period OR equivalent demonstrable experience
- Knowledge of care related procedures, clinical observation, relevant legislation
Desirable
- Level 3 qualification in a healthcare related subject OR a portfolio of equivalent demonstrable experience
Knowledge and Experience
Essential
- Previous care experience
- Person centred care approach
- Understanding of mental health and/or learning disabilities needs
- Safeguarding knowledge
- Awareness of carer needs
Skills and Competencies
Essential
- Good interpersonal and communication skills
- Ability to undertake PMVA (Prevention and Management of Violence and Aggression) training
- Verbal and written communication skills
- Effective Time Management
Desirable
- Ability to prioritise tasks
- Accurate record keeping skills
